/* -------------------------------------------------------------------------
Test: UNICOD02
Component: JScript
Major Area: Unicode compliance
Test Area: Unicode values used in JScript variable identifiers
Keywords: unicode literal escape variable identifier eval
---------------------------------------------------------------------------
Purpose: Verify the functionality of new or changed features
Scenarios:
1. Upper case letters (Lu)
2. Lower case letters (Ll)
3. Title case letters (Lt)
4. Modifier letters (Lm)
5. Other letters (Lo)
6. Number letters (Nl)
7. Space separators (Zs)
8. Non-spacing marks (Mn)
9. Combining spacing marks (Mc)
10. Unicode digits (Nd)
11. Connector punctuation (Pc)
12. Format control (Cf)
Abstract: Unicode characters are legal for use in variable identifiers,
with the exception of spacing marks and format characters.
---------------------------------------------------------------------------
Category: Functionality
Product: JScript
Related Files:
Notes:
---------------------------------------------------------------------------
-------------------------------------------------------------------------*/
